AI 에이전트에 스크립트 추가
에서 AI 에이전트 스튜디오AI 에이전트에 추가하는 스크립트를 생성합니다. 스크립트를 사용하면 스크립팅 가능한 API와 백엔드 통합을 사용하여 AI 에이전트를 지원할 수 있습니다.
시작하기 전에
필요한 역할: sn_aia.admin
프로시저
- 다음으로 이동 모두 > AI 에이전트 스튜디오 > 생성 및 관리 > AI 에이전트.
- 스크립트를 추가할 AI 에이전트를 열고 도구 및 정보 추가 섹션으로 이동합니다.
- 도구 추가 드롭다운 목록에서 스크립트를 선택합니다.
-
양식에서 필드를 채웁니다.
표 1. 스크립트 양식 추가 필드 설명 추가할 기록 운영 유형 선택 기존 항목을 선택하면 현재 AI 에이전트 또는 다른 AI 에이전트에서 사용하는 기록 운영 도구를 선택할 수 있습니다. 특정 AI 에이전트의 필요에 맞게 해당 도구의 설정을 변경할 수 있습니다. 이름 스크립트에 지정할 이름입니다.
설명 스크립트에 대한 설명과 AI 에이전트를 지원하기 위해 수행할 작업입니다. 주:이 설명은 LLM(대규모 언어 모델)으로 전송됩니다.스크립트 입력 스크립트에 사용할 입력 이름 및 설명입니다. LLM은 이름과 설명을 사용하여 런타임에 사용해야 하는 값을 결정합니다. 예: 입력 이름은 task_record_sys_id 이고 설명은 sys_id of the Task Record, this is mandatory입니다.
스크립트 스크립트에 대한 객체 클래스 또는 함수를 포함하는 JavaScript 코드입니다. 주:보안을 향상시키려면 GlideRecord 대신 GlideRecordSecure를 사용하고 addEncodedQuery() 대신 addUserEncodedQuery()를 사용합니다.실행 모드 스크립트에 대한 실행 모드: - 감독됨: AI 에이전트가 실행되는 동안 이 도구를 실행하는 동안 사람 에이전트의 입력이 필요합니다.
- 자율: AI 에이전트가 실행되는 동안 이 도구를 실행하는 동안 라이브 에이전트의 입력이 필요하지 않습니다.
출력 표시 패널 또는 다음에서 가상 에이전트도구 실행의 출력을 표시할 수 있는 권한입니다Now Assist. - 예
- 아니요
메시지 처리 중 도구가 실행 중일 때 사용자에게 표시할 메시지입니다. 출력 변환 전략 LLM이 도구 간 정보와 다른 에이전트에게 정보를 전달할 때 결과를 표시하는 스타일입니다. - 없음
- 간결
- 단락
- 자세한 정보 표시
- 사용자 지정
-
추가를 선택합니다.
스크립트 도구는 도구 및 정보 추가 페이지의 스크립트 섹션에 추가됩니다.